CORE 419: No Sale!
There's a new study saying we are less interested in deep strategy games. Let's dig through that a bit and see what makes sense. Also, we played a load of games. (see below for more.) MS trying to buy valve rumors is horse poop. Arrowhead saw a big change this week, all in service to players according to the CEO. Fortnite is getting all kinds of Fallout stuff, and possible Mad Max stuff, maybe even today. Your emails and texts and lost more on today's CORE podcast!

CORE 417: Industry Flux
These layoffs and closures at Microsoft, affecting studios like Arkane Austin and Tango Gameworks. The silence from Phil Spencer raises questions about the future of AAA gaming and highlights the negative impacts of industry consolidation, a topic that Ybarra has also commented on, albeit controversially. Helldivers 2 drama ends, kind of, and new inductees into the Video Game Hall of Fame. The upcoming Rogue-Like DLC for Wildermyth and the discontinuation of sharing Nintendo Switch screenshots to Twitter. Your texts too!
